资源简介

struts2 spring mybatis easyui 权限管理系统 加博客前台页面管理

资源截图

代码片段和文件信息

package com.softlin.web.dao.baseDB;

import java.util.List;

import org.springframework.orm.ibatis.support.SqlMapClientDaoSupport;
import org.springframework.stereotype.Component;

@Component(“baseIbatisDao“)
public  class baseIbatisDao extends SqlMapClientDaoSupport{

//private SqlSession sqlSession; ibatis3对象
/**
 * 查询集合没有参数
 * @param statementName bean sql的名称
 * @return
 * @throws Exception
 */
public List queryForList(String statementName) throws Exception{
return this.getSqlMapClientTemplate().queryForList(statementName);
}

/**
 * 查询集合
 * @param statementName bean sql的名称
 * @param obj 参数对象
 * @return
 * @throws Exception
 */
public List queryForList(String statementNameobject obj) throws Exception{
return this.getSqlMapClientTemplate().queryForList(statementNameobj);

}

/**
 * 分页查询
 * @param statementName bean sql的名称
 * @param obj 参数对象
 * @param page 页数
 * @param size 行数
 * @return
 * @throws Exception
 */
public List queryForList(String statementNameobject objint pageint size) throws Exception{
return this.getSqlMapClientTemplate().queryForList(statementNameobjpagesize);
}

public object queryForobject(String sql)throws Exception{
return this.getSqlMapClientTemplate().queryForobject(sql);
}


// /**
//  * json格式分页(有问题)
//  * @param sql sql语句
//  * @param page 页数
//  * @param rows 行数
//  * @return
//  * @throws Exception
//  */
// public JSONobject queryForJson(String sqlint pageint rows)throws Exception{
// Integer count=getCount(sql);
// List list=this.getSqlMapClientTemplate().queryForList(sql);
// List list=this.getSqlMapClientTemplate().queryForList(sql page rows);
// JSONobject json=new JSONobject();
// json.put(“total“ count);
// json.put(“rows“ JSONArray.fromobject(list));
// return json;
// }

/**
 * 保存数据
 * @param statementName bean sql的名称
 * @param obj 参数对象
 * @return
 */
public object save(String statementNameobject obj)throws Exception{
return  this.getSqlMapClientTemplate().insert(statementNameobj);
}

/**
 * 修改
 * @param statementName bean sql的名称
 * @param obj 参数对象
 * @return
 */
public int update(String statementNameobject obj)throws Exception{
return  this.getSqlMapClientTemplate().update(statementNameobj);
}

/**
 * 删除
 * @param statementName bean sql的名称
 * @param obj 参数对象
 * @return
 */
public int delete(String statementNameobject obj)throws Exception{
return  this.getSqlMapClientTemplate().delete(statementNameobj);
}

public void insert(String statementNameobject obj) throws Exception {   
       this.getSqlMapClientTemplate().insert(statementNameobj);   
    }

/**
 * 获取结果总数
 * @param sql sql语句
 * @return
 * @throws Exception
 */
public Integer getCount(String sql)throws Exception{
return (Integer) this.getSqlMapClientTemplate().queryForobject(“common.selectCount“sql);
}

}


 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     目录           0  2014-09-27 16:32  softlin_new\
     文件        6426  2014-09-27 16:41  softlin_new\.classpath
     目录           0  2018-01-29 00:24  softlin_new\.myeclipse\
     文件         306  2014-09-27 16:31  softlin_new\.mymetadata
     文件        1013  2014-09-27 16:31  softlin_new\.project
     目录           0  2014-09-27 16:31  softlin_new\.settings\
     文件         629  2014-09-27 16:45  softlin_new\.settings\org.eclipse.jdt.core.prefs
     目录           0  2014-09-27 16:32  softlin_new\WebRoot\
     目录           0  2014-09-27 16:31  softlin_new\WebRoot\meta-INF\
     文件          39  2014-09-27 16:31  softlin_new\WebRoot\meta-INF\MANIFEST.MF
     目录           0  2014-09-27 16:32  softlin_new\WebRoot\WEB-INF\
     目录           0  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\
     目录           0  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\com\
     目录           0  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\com\softlin\
     目录           0  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\com\softlin\service\
     目录           0  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\com\softlin\service\test\
     文件         950  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\com\softlin\service\test\InitTestAction.class
     文件         999  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\com\softlin\service\test\InitTestDao.class
     文件         807  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\com\softlin\service\test\InitTestService.class
     目录           0  2018-01-29 00:24  softlin_new\WebRoot\WEB-INF\classes\com\softlin\tag\
     文件         223  2013-05-05 13:43  softlin_new\WebRoot\WEB-INF\classes\ehcache.xml
     文件        3894  2014-04-19 20:38  softlin_new\WebRoot\WEB-INF\classes\global.datasource.xml
     文件        3053  2014-04-19 20:32  softlin_new\WebRoot\WEB-INF\classes\global.multi.transaction.xml
     文件        1699  2014-04-19 18:35  softlin_new\WebRoot\WEB-INF\classes\global.service.xml
     文件        2307  2014-04-19 20:31  softlin_new\WebRoot\WEB-INF\classes\global.transaction.xml
     文件         623  2014-04-19 18:29  softlin_new\WebRoot\WEB-INF\classes\ibatis-base.xml
     文件         610  2014-02-21 23:08  softlin_new\WebRoot\WEB-INF\classes\ibatis-config.xml
     文件        1414  2014-04-19 20:38  softlin_new\WebRoot\WEB-INF\classes\jdbc.properties
     文件        3151  2014-04-19 20:23  softlin_new\WebRoot\WEB-INF\classes\log4j.properties
     目录           0  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\org\
     目录           0  2016-08-20 23:16  softlin_new\WebRoot\WEB-INF\classes\org\apache\
............此处省略3544个文件信息

评论

共有 条评论